Abstract:
Task analysis is a crucial technique used in various fields to understand, dissect, and optimize complex processes. In this comprehensive guide, we will delve into the concept of task analysis, its significance, methodologies, and practical applications across different domains. By the end of this 3000-word journey, you’ll have a solid understanding of how to conduct a task analysis and how it can improve processes and systems.
Introduction
1.1 What is Task Analysis?
Task analysis is a systematic method for understanding and describing the actions, activities, and processes involved in a particular task or set of tasks. It is a fundamental process used in various fields, including psychology, human-computer interaction, ergonomics, and many others. Task analysis provides a detailed view of how tasks are performed, helping designers, researchers, and practitioners to optimize processes, design better systems, and improve overall efficiency.
1.2 Importance
The significance lies in its ability to:
1.Identify bottlenecks and inefficiencies in a process.
2.Enhance user experience in product design and development.
3.Improve safety and reduce errors in complex tasks.
4.Aid in training and education program development.
5.Streamline project management and resource allocation.
Ensure that systems and processes align with user needs and goals.
Methods of Task Analysis
There are several methods of conducting analysis, each suited to different situations and objectives. Let’s explore some common methods:
2.1 Hierarchical Task Analysis (HTA)
Hierarchical Analysis breaks down a task into a hierarchical structure of subtasks. It is particularly useful for understanding the relationships and dependencies between different elements of a task.
2.2 Cognitive Task Analysis (CTA)
Cognitive focuses on the cognitive processes, strategies, and decision-making involved in a task. This method is crucial in domains where mental workload and decision-making are critical, such as aviation and healthcare.
2.3 Goal-Directed Task Analysis (GDTA)
GDTA emphasizes the goals and objectives of a task, enabling a clearer understanding of why tasks are performed in a specific way. This method is beneficial in uncovering the underlying motivations of users.
2.4 Ethnographic Task Analysis
Ethnographic involves observing and immersing oneself in the task environment to gain a deep understanding of cultural, social, and contextual factors that influence task performance. It is often used in anthropology and sociology.
2.5 User-Centered Task Analysis
User-Centered places the user at the center of the analysis. It focuses on understanding how users interact with systems or processes to achieve their goals, making it crucial in human-centered design.
Steps in Conducting Task Analysis
To perform an analysis effectively, you can follow these general steps:
3.1 Identify the Task
Define the task you want to analyze. Clearly articulate its purpose and scope.
3.2 Collect Data
Gather information through various means, such as observation, interviews, documentation, and existing research.
3.3 Identify Subtasks
Break the task into its constituent subtasks or steps. This step involves decomposing the task into manageable parts.
3.4 Analyze Task Sequences
Examine the order and relationships between subtasks. Determine which subtasks are dependent on others and their logical flow.
3.5 Create Task Models
Use appropriate modeling techniques to represent the task visually. This might include flowcharts, hierarchical diagrams, or timelines.
3.6 Validate the Analysis
Check the accuracy of your analysis by comparing it with expert opinions, user feedback, or by conducting validation studies.
Applications
4.1 Human-Computer Interaction (HCI)
In HCI, analysis is used to design user-friendly interfaces, ensuring that software and hardware align with users’ needs and mental models.
4.2 Industrial and Occupational Ergonomics
Ergonomics experts use task analysis to design workspaces, tools, and equipment to minimize physical strain and improve worker productivity.
4.3 Healthcare and Patient Care
analysis plays a crucial role in healthcare to improve patient safety, optimize medical procedures, and enhance the quality of care.
4.4 Education and Training
In education, analysis is employed to design effective learning programs and instructional materials, ensuring students achieve specific learning outcomes.
4.5 Software Development
Developers use analysis to understand user needs, which guides the design and development of software applications.
4.6 Project Management
Project managers apply analysis to allocate resources, set timelines, and ensure project tasks align with the overall project goals.
Benefits and Limitations
5.1 Benefits
Enhances efficiency and productivity.
Improves user satisfaction and experience.
Minimizes errors and safety risks.
Facilitates clear communication and documentation.
Assists in problem-solving and decision-making.
5.2 Limitations
Time-consuming and resource-intensive.
May not account for unexpected variations in task performance.
Requires expertise to conduct effectively.
Limited to the information available at the time of analysis.
Can overlook the impact of external factors on task performance.
Case Study: Task Analysis in Action
6.1 Problem Statement
Imagine a manufacturing company is facing inefficiencies in their production process, resulting in delayed shipments and increased costs.
6.2 Task Analysis Approach
The company conducts a hierarchical analysis of their production process, identifying subtasks, dependencies, and potential bottlenecks.
6.3 Results and Impact
By reorganizing the production process and implementing automation in critical areas, the company reduces production time, lowers costs, and meets shipping deadlines consistently.
Challenges and Future Trends
7.1 Challenges
Challenges include adapting to rapidly changing environments, ensuring the relevance of analyzed tasks, and integrating digital tools for data collection and analysis.
7.2 Future Trends in Task Analysis
The future lies in incorporating AI and machine learning for data processing, as well as real-time analysis to adapt to dynamic work environments.
Conclusion
In conclusion, task analysis is a powerful tool that enables us to dissect complex tasks, improve processes, and design user-centered systems. Whether in the realms of technology, healthcare, or education, task analysis empowers us to make informed decisions, optimize performance, and enhance the user experience. By understanding its methodologies, applications, benefits, and limitations, you can harness the full potential in your professional endeavors, driving efficiency and innovation in a variety of domains.